Transaction 616d1179a33ccf5b932adf3813b68a60fa2a5d3b8463ed02074e3a2f19bd12e5

block
f28843616a017b88518ef4931aaf13ce5fe225f9c12a43edf0310073e035acfe

1 Input

3 Outputs